What Evidence Did Alfred Wegener Have For Continental Drift?

Wegener used fossil evidence to support his continental drift hypothesis. The fossils of these organisms are found on lands that are now far apart. Grooves and rock deposits left by ancient glaciers are found today on different continents very close to the equator.Aug 11 2020

What is Alfred Wegener theory?

In the early 20th century Wegener published a paper explaining his theory that the continental landmasses were “drifting” across the Earth sometimes plowing through oceans and into each other. He called this movement continental drift.

What evidence did Wegener rely on in the formulation of his theory of continental drift What evidence did he lack?

Alfred Wegener in the first three decades of this century and DuToit in the 1920s and 1930s gathered evidence that the continents had moved. They based their idea of continental drift on several lines of evidence: fit of the continents paleoclimate indicators truncated geologic features and fossils.

Why did scientists reject Wegener’s idea of continental drift?

The main reason that Wegener’s hypothesis was not accepted was because he suggested no mechanism for moving the continents. He thought the force of Earth’s spin was sufficient to cause continents to move but geologists knew that rocks are too strong for this to be true.

What did Alfred Wegener do?

Alfred Wegener in full Alfred Lothar Wegener (born November 1 1880 Berlin Germany—died November 1930 Greenland) German meteorologist and geophysicist who formulated the first complete statement of the continental drift hypothesis. … He made three more expeditions to Greenland in 1912–13 1929 and 1930.

How did Alfred Wegener prove his theory?

Wegener supported his theory by demonstrating the biological and geological similarities between continents. South America and Africa contain fossils of animals found only on those two continents with corresponding geographic ranges.

What advice did Alfred Wegener use to support his theory of continental drift?

Wegener used geologic fossil and glacial evidence from opposite sides of the Atlantic Ocean to support his theory of continental drift. For example he said that there were geological similarities between the Appalachian Mountains in North America and the Scottish Highlands.

What did the theory of continental drift state?

Continental drift is the hypothesis that the Earth’s continents have moved over geologic time relative to each other thus appearing to have “drifted” across the ocean bed. The speculation that continents might have ‘drifted’ was first put forward by Abraham Ortelius in 1596.

How does evidence of glaciation in Africa support the theory of continental drift?

There is also much climate evidence supporting continental drift most notable of which is glacial activity. … Also glacial striations (essentially ‘cut marks’) found in rocks from the movement of this ice sheet show that the direction in which it was moving was outwards from a central point in southern Africa.

Where did Alfred Wegener do his research?

In 1905 Wegener went to work at the Royal Prussian Aeronautical Observatory near Berlin where he used kites and balloons to study the upper atmosphere. He also flew in hot air balloons indeed in 1906 he and his brother Kurt broke the world endurance record by staying aloft for more than 52 hours.

What geological process generates the world’s longest undersea mountain chain?

The Mid-Atlantic Ridge (MAR) is known as a mid-ocean ridge an underwater mountain system formed by plate tectonics. It is the result of a divergent plate boundary that runs from 87° N – about 333 km (207 mi) south of the North Pole – to 54 °S just north of the coast of Antarctica.
